RBC Wealth Management, part of Royal Bank of Canada, have filled the position left vacant by the departure last year of Grace Barki.

Gea 160Tho Gea Hong (pictured left) has been named as the new Head of Wealth Management, Southeast Asia. Based in Singapore, Gea Hong will be responsible for providing the strategic direction and managerial counsel for the wealth manager’s Southeast Asia business.

Her mandate will also support RBC Wealth Management’s sales, marketing and investments initiatives relating to its Southeast Asia market, the bank said in a press release to finews.asia.

Gea Hong is an industry veteran with 27 years’ experience in financial services, the last 11 of which focused on the Southeast Asia private banking market.

Exits EFG Bank

Having held previous roles with DBS and Merrill Lynch International Bank, Gea Hong joins RBC Wealth Management from EFG Bank, where she held the role of Head of Private Banking & Deputy CEO, Southeast Asia.

«We are pleased to have Geo Hong join RBC Wealth Management. Her years of experience, deep industry knowledge and leadership will further enable us to serve our clients in Southeast Asia and position us to win more business in this important market,» said Barend Janssens, Head, RBC Wealth Management, Asia.

Her predecessor Grace Barki was recently appointed as Managing Director covering Southeast Asia at Pictet in Singapore.
